Why Traffic May Rise or Fall
Sportsvirals' organic traffic patterns are heavily influenced by the sporting calendar. Major events like the Olympics, World Cups, or championship playoffs typically lead to substantial traffic surges. Conversely, off-seasons or periods with fewer high-profile events can result in natural dips. Search engine algorithm updates, particularly those focused on content quality, E-E-A-T signals (Experience, Expertise, Authoritativeness, Trustworthiness), and freshness, can significantly impact visibility. The competitive landscape, with numerous sports news outlets vying for attention, also plays a critical role; if competitors publish more comprehensive or timely content, Sportsvirals' visibility may decline. Content decay, where older articles lose relevance or accuracy, can also contribute to a gradual traffic reduction over time.
How the Site Could Improve Organic Visibility
To enhance its organic visibility, Sportsvirals could focus on several strategic areas. Expanding topic clusters around specific teams, players, or leagues would create more authoritative content hubs. Implementing structured data markup (e.g., Schema.org for news articles, sports events, or player profiles) could improve how search engines understand and display its content in SERPs, potentially leading to rich results. Developing an internal linking strategy that connects related articles and directs link equity effectively would strengthen content authority. Addressing content gaps by identifying underserved niches within sports commentary or data could attract new audiences. Regularly updating evergreen content with fresh statistics, outcomes, or analysis would also maintain its relevance and search performance.
What to Check Before Trusting Traffic Estimates
When assessing any domain's traffic, particularly in a dynamic content niche like sports, it is crucial to approach third-party estimates with caution. These tools often rely on sample data and algorithmic projections, which may not fully capture the nuances of a site's specific audience or traffic sources. For Sportsvirals, verifying traffic estimates would involve consulting direct analytics data (e.g., Google Analytics, server logs) if available. Cross-referencing data from multiple competitive intelligence platforms can offer a broader, albeit still estimated, perspective. Understanding a site's content strategy, publication frequency, and how it aligns with major sporting events provides essential context that numerical estimates alone cannot convey. The true measure of a site's performance lies in its first-party data.
